Author:Bloch, B.
Title:Regional studies for international business: a German perspective
Journal:Journal of Teaching in International Business
1997 : VOL. 8:3, p. 45-66
Index terms:TEACHING METHODS
INTERNATIONAL BUSINESS
GERMANY
Language:eng
Abstract:This article provides an interdisciplinary overview and some insights into the subject of business-oriented regional studies, with the focus falling on Germany. The content and boundaries of regional studies are considered in the broadest context and illustrated by means of a Venn diagram. Special attention is paid to the difference between "explicit" business study (material relating directly to business) and the value of "implicit" non-business material. The relationship between regional studies and intercultural management is also considered.
